Their supplications quickly proved unnecessary. After listening to city officials testify and respond to a few scattered questions from his colleagues, committee chairman Darrell Issa took control of the hearing and revealed what was really on his mind: budget autonomy for the District.
“I am going to be offering an alternative that I hope [Norton] will join with me on that provides a mechanism for a separate vote and separate consideration of the District’s funds,” Issa said, adding, “I’m looking for some sort of a structured mechanism to where this committee could say, ‘They have a plan, they can live without federal dollars and still meet the requirement,’ and each time that is received, it would allow us to say, ‘We have no reason to be in the way of your spending your dollars if you can make the commitment.’”
Everyone in the room was taken by surprise—including Issa’s aides, who had no idea their boss was going to propose the policy long sought by D.C. officials to free the city’s operations from the mercy of a fickle Congress.
“I was hugely surprised and ecstatic,” Gray recalls. “I’ve been in office now almost two years, and it was one of the moments that was absolutely wonderful for me, to see this man who’s obviously done a great job on the Hill, obviously highly respected—he didn’t have to get involved with the District of Columbia at all. He has chosen to do that, and he’s done it in a way that has supported the people of this city.”
“I about picked myself up off the floor,” says Norton. “No one thought this hearing would have that result.”

After all, Issa is a conservative Republican from California, a Tea Party favorite best known as his party’s official thorn in the side of the Obama administration. After the 2008 election, Issa lobbied hard for the top Republican spot on the Oversight Committee, pledging to fight “Barack Obama’s agenda of big government, trillions in new spending, and higher taxes.” When Republicans took the majority in 2011, Issa said he hoped to hold “seven hearings a week, times 40 weeks,” on alleged government wrongdoing.
Issa hasn’t disappointed. His investigations have probed nearly every aspect of the administration’s work from birth control to Benghazi, with such impartial hearings as last February’s “Lines Crossed: Separation of Church and State. Has the Obama Administration Trampled on Freedom of Religion and Freedom of Conscience?”
